Our flagship product

Bahriya Kubernetes Engine.

The same Kubernetes distribution we run our public cloud on, available for on-premise installation. One flat license per cluster. No per-node, per-CPU or per-core surprises.

Beginning atUS $12,000 / cluster / year

Irrespective of node count or CPU. Support & maintenance contracts available on request.

The Mamluk standard

Service. Integrity. Determination.

The word Mamluk in Arabic literally means one who serves. The Mamluks of Cairo — slave-soldiers who rose to govern Egypt and Syria for nearly three centuries — built their reputation on chivalry, technical mastery and an uncompromising devotion to their craft.

We took the name deliberately. Every product we build, every engagement we accept, and every line of code we ship is judged against that inheritance.
